The Diploma in Medical Qigong
Students will have gained the Three Treasures School of TCM Certificate in
Medical Qi Gong or an equivalent qualification from another Centre, before starting on the Diploma level modules.
To obtain this award students will have satisfactorily completed a further four modules over a period of four months based on home assignments and one weekend session per month at the Centre plus Supervision.

Supervision
In the two months following the end of the course students will submit for assessment case notes for a number of patients treated. They will also be required to submit their MQg Journal as evidence of their continuing practice and development.
